What we're looking for.

Maverick employs talented, highly motivated college students to help our clients with software development and testing projects. We look for drive and foundation — not a complete résumé.

Qualifications
  • Self-motivated, quick learner, enthusiastic, and eager to apply knowledge
  • Strong work ethic, problem-solving, and testing skills
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ills
  • Experience with AWS, Azure, C#, Java, HTML, CSS, or Python is a plus — but not required
  • Currently pursuing a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Software Engineering, CIS, or a related field
Where we work

Maverick locations.

Students hired by Maverick work from a development office near their university campus, or remotely as a member of a virtual development team.

Minnesota State University, Mankato

Providing real-world experience to students since 2006.

  • Employs students from surrounding universities
  • Dedicated partnership with Thomson Reuters
  • Students work in a team environment
